Андрей Смирнов
Время чтения: ~7 мин.
Просмотров: 3 751

Не удалось найти лицензионное соглашение — oшибка установки Windows

logo12-1.pngОшибка при установке windows 10 “Не удалось найти лицензионное соглашение. Проверьте, что источник установки указан правильно и перезапустите установку”Posted on 05.01.2017 in Программные ошибки, решение проблем, Установка и восстановление ОС

Начиналось всё просто: поставить для системы быстрый и надежный ssd-шник, хорошую видеокарту и windows 10 для большей производительности в играх.

До этого стояла 7-ка. Пересобрал системник, начал установку.

При установки 10-ки на новый диск выдал такую ошибку: “Не удалось найти лицензионное соглашение. Проверьте, что источник установки указан правильно и перезапустите установку”.

Столкнулся с этим в первый раз. Пробовал 5 разных версий 10-ки, с дисков и флешки, результат тот же. Делал по разному образ на флешку (с помощью Rufus  или  Windows USB/DVD Download Tool), ради интереса. Результат тот же.

Проблема не в оперативной памяти или жестком диске (проверял) как можно увидеть на форумах погуглив.

37347367.png

Способы решения проблемы

  1. Другой дистрибутив, есть вероятность, что записанные дистрибутивы – битые или не верно подготовлен загрузочный носитель. Скачайте оригинальный образ и установите его. А если сборку, то только с хорошими отзывами. Это самый быстрый вариант.
  2. Образ, который Вы скачали не предназначен для установки из под установленной ОС и на компьютерах с UEFI с GPT дисками, т.е. только начисто и желательно с файловой системой MBR. На компьютерах с UEFI и дисковой системой GPT сборки такого типа не поддерживаются. Лучше включить стандартный интерфейс BIOS, а GPT диск преобразовать в MBR (в опции Secure Boot поставить Disable, в опции OS Mode Selection поставить Uefi and Legacy Boot)
  3. При обновлении системы (с Xp до 7/8.1 до 10 или 7/8.1 до 10) ключ установки можно указать установщику, как описано на http://forum.oszone.net/thread-303601-2.html:
    1. через подготовленный файл ответов, правильно названный и размещенный в структуре образа или явно указанный установщику setup.exe /unattend:”путь_до_файла_ключей”
    2. или принудительно указанный через установщик код установки продукта setup.exe /pkey XXXXX-XXXXX-XXXXX-XXXXX-XXXXX

У меня был 1-й вариант, образ с которого я ставил был битый. Перезаписал и всё поставилось без проблем. Если у Вас есть другие варианты решений, хотите оставить комментарий, вопрос или предложение, чтобы другим было легче решить эту проблему – буду только рад! Пишите ниже.

Решение распространённой ошибки при установке ОС Windows — «Не удалось найти лицензионное соглашение. Проверьте, что источник установки указан правильно и перезапустите установку» — на примере чистой установки лицензионной Windows Server 2019 на новый сервер HPE Proliant.19989_600.jpgРЕШЕНИЕ:Установка проводилась через локальную сеть.1. Перед процессом установки настроить адекватно UEFI на сервере;2. Вставьте (на админском ПК) чистую флешку в USB порт. Она должна быть отформатирована в exFat.3. Запустите (на админском ПК) командную строку с правами администратора.4. Выполните в данной последовательности команды:

diskpart

list disk

select disk (где Х — это номер вашего USB диска)

clean

create part pri

select part 1

format fs=ntfs quick или format fs=fat32 quick (в зависимости от настроек UEFI вашего сервера)

active

exit

5. Запустите свою программу для работы с ISO-образами. Смонтируйте на неё ваш дистрибутив с инсталляционным пакетом Windows Server и скопируйте всё содержимое данного диска на данную флешку.

ВАЖНО! Копировать не сам образ ISO, а его содержимое.6. ИНЪЕКЦИЯ ФАЙЛОВ. Может потребоваться вам во время процесса установки ОС (см. рис.2), когда кнопка «Далее» просто недоступна.20276_600.jpg

6.1. Подключите к USB-портам сервера 2 внешних DVD — дисковода (на данном этапе можно использовать флешки).7. С этой страницы (https://support.hpe.com/hpsc/swd/public/detail?swItemId=MTX_16d787338ac1492fab47e5545e#tab3) скачайте файл cp037222.exe (1.6 MB) и распакуйте его в папку на рабочем столе. Потом содержимое этой папки запишите на  1 DVD-диск и во время установки сделйте инъекцию соотв. файла через внешний ДВД, подключенный к серверу. Имя файла для инъекции вам придется уточнять в техподдержке производителя вашего «железа».

С этой страницы (https://support.hpe.com/hpsc/swd/public/detail?swItemId=MTX_5e75fa313d5342d498bff6df6e#tab3) скачайте файл cp037451.exe (659 KB) и распакуйте его в папку на рабочем столе. Потом содержимое этой папки запишите на 2 DVD и во время установки сделайте инъекцию через второй внешний ДВД, подключенный к серверу.  Имя файла для инъекции вам придется уточнять в техподдержке производителя вашего «железа».

После инъекций Ваша инсталляция примет примерно такой вид (см. рис.3)20546_600.pngКнопка «Далее» теперь доступна. Дальше — стандартная процедура установки Windows Server.Отдельное «спасибо» хочу сказать представителям техподдержки компаний Hewlett Packard Enterprise и  Microsoft — первой за тупость индусов в техподдержке, второй — за маркетинговую политику. Благодаря им обоим пришлось пройти через вышеизложенный геморрой. У HPE пришлось по 3 раза индуса подгонять, чотб добиться по удаленке того, что надо во время установки. Microsoft — (за жадность), простите — за успешную маркетинговую политику. Т.к сразу пытаются перевести на платную техподдержку — а это от 500 до 2000 доларов. Или посылают лесом. Также телефоны техподдержки Майкрософт в Беларуси были недоступны. Вот и ставь после этого лицензионные версии.ПС. Через несколько дней было установлено в процессе эксплуатации, что на сервер не установилось половина драйверов устройств. Запрос в тех поддержку — ответ: скачать и установить это мега обновление (http://h17007.www1.hpe.com/us/en/enterprise/servers/products/service_pack/spp/index.aspx). Скачали, установить не удается, снова запрос в тех поддержку. Ответ: чтобы установить это обновление надо скачать и установить это обновление (https://support.hpe.com/hpsc/swd/public/detail?sp4ts.oid=1010093150&swItemId=MTX_0458e6cda96240eaba1c884b03&swEnvOid=4184#tab1), и это (https://support.hpe.com/hpsc/swd/public/detail?sp4ts.oid=1010093150&swItemId=MTX_c192944c1344463eab9229004d&swEnvOid=4184#tab3), и это (https://support.hpe.com/hpsc/swd/public/detail?sp4ts.oid=1010093150&swItemId=MTX_ed588c3ccbb848949fc9124d8a&swEnvOid=4184). Также может понадобиться и это (https://support.hpe.com/hpsc/swd/public/detail?sp4ts.oid=1010026819&swItemId=MTX_f03fe52db6774fc88847c1131a&swEnvOid=4184). когда у вас полезут на лоб глаза — ставим по очереди эти обновы, потом запускаем установку упомянутого мегаобновления.И только после этого ваш сервер приобретёт «рабочую форму».

При установке Windows 10 в качестве операционной системы на новой виртуальной машине под управлением гипервизора Hyper-V, столкнулся с ситуацией, когда установка Windows с установочного образа прерывается после выбора ОС с ошибкой:

Windows cannot find the Microsoft Software License Terms.  Make sure the installation sources are valid and restart the installation.

windows-cannot-find-the-microsoft-software-license.png

В русской версии Windows ошибка выглядит так:

Установка Windows отменена.

Не удалось найти лицензионное соглашение. Проверьте, что источник установки указан правильно и перезапустите установку.

ustanovka-windows-otmenena-ne-udalos-najti-licen.png

После нажатия ОК, выполняется перезагрузка компьютера и повторный запуска установки Windows, ошибка «Не удалось найти лицензионное соглашение» при этом повторяется и так по кругу.

Данная ошибка, как оказалась, может быть связана с двумя совершенно различными причинами (я сталкивался с обоими вариантами):

  1. В том случае, если установка Windows 10 / Windows Server 2016 (и более старых версий ОС) производится внутри виртуальной машины, убедитесь, что вы выделили данной машине достаточно оперативной памяти. В моем случае, на сервере Hyper-V для данной ВМ было выделено всего 512 Мб памяти и включена опция использования динамической памяти (Enable Dynamic memory) с возможной ситуацией Memory overcommitment. Увеличьте размер выделенной ВМ памяти хотя бы до 1024 Мб и перезапустите процесс установки. hyper-v-uvelichit-pamyat-dlya-virtualnoj-mashiny.pngПримечание. В качестве небольшого обходного решения, можно воспользоваться таким трюком. Перед началом установки Windows нажмите сочетание клавиш Shift+F10 и в окне командной строки выполнить команду, создающую файл подкачки: wpeutil createpagefile /path=C:pf.sys . После этого переключитесь в окно установки и начните установку Windows. Установка должна продолжится без ошибок даже при маленьком объеме памяти.
  2. В том случае, если данная ошибка возникает при установке Windows непосредственно на железо (на компьютер, ноутбук), а не в виртуальной машине, убедитесь, что в системе имеется достаточное количество оперативной памяти. Если памяти достаточно, скорее всего проблема с самим установочным образом (дистрибутивом) Windows (возможно он поврежден, и стоит попробовать воспользоваться другим диском или образом), либо проблема в несоответствии редакции продукта в файле ei.cfg и ключа продукта в файле pid.txt. В этом случае можно на установочном диске в каталоге sources создать текстовый файл с именем ei.cfg и следующим содержимым:[Channel]OEMei-cfg-oem-channel.pngЕсли в указанной папке уже есть файл ei.cfg, смените значение Channel с Retail на OEM (т.к. похоже, что вы пытаетесь установить Enterprise редакцию с розничного дистрибутива). Необходимо вручную отредактировать ISO файл установочного образа Windows с помощью любого ISO редактора (WinISO), добавив указанный файл и перезаписать установочный DVD / USB диск.

    Либо можно указать ключ установки Windows так: setup.exe /pkey XXXXX-XXXXX-XXXXX-XXXXX-XXXXX

Используемые источники:

  • https://komp.msk.ru/ne-udalos-najti-licenzionnoe-soglashenie/
  • https://maksim-garmash.livejournal.com/118870.html
  • https://winitpro.ru/index.php/2018/03/26/ne-udalos-najti-licenzionnoe-soglashenie-oshibka-ustanovki-windows/

Рейтинг автора
5
Подборку подготовил
Андрей Ульянов
Наш эксперт
Написано статей
168
Ссылка на основную публикацию
Похожие публикации